2022 Provence Rosé Case
Wines included
Coteaux d'Aix en Provence Rosé, Château Vignelaure 2022
Provence rosé from one of the top estates. This is made from a blend of grenache, syrah, cabernet sauvignon and rolle, better known as vermentino. Full-flavoured and savoury with a lovely expression of ripe red-berried fruit.
Côtes de Provence Rosé, Clos de l'Ours 2022
Deliciously full and fruity rosé, dry with a whiff of redcurrants. This comes from the backwoods of Provence near the spectacular Verdon canyon. It is perfection with grills or a Caesar salad.
Côtes de Provence Rosé de Léoube 2022
A pale and fragrant pink that captures the essence of Provence. Fruity with hints of strawberry and redcurrant and a touch of herbs. Full-flavoured and refreshing and a perfect foil for a number of dishes from Mediterranean-inspired to Far Eastern.
Les Baux de Provence Rosé, Château Romanin 2022
From a remarkable estate with its own Templar castle and cellars hewn into the rock and aptly named 'cathedral', this is a very fine, bone-dry, Provence rosé with weight and a touch of spice. Quite outstanding. It's at its best with food where its complexity will enhance many dishes.
Bandol Rosé, Dupuy de Lôme 2022
A stylish, full-flavoured rose that would be best with food, particularly grills and salads. As this comes from Bandol in Provence, mourvèdre makes up a majority of the blend with grenache and cinsault in support.
Côtes de Provence, Miraval Rosé 2022
